How they compare

Lithuania currently reports 1.05 billion current US$ against 770.00 million current US$ in Haiti, a difference of 284.07 million current US$.

That makes Lithuania's figure about 1.4 times Haiti's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Lithuania ahead.

Globally, Haiti ranks 59th and Lithuania ranks 56th of 195 countries.

Personal remittances comprise personal transfers and compensation of employees. Personal transfers consist of all current transfers in cash or in kind made or received by resident households to or from nonresident households. Personal transfers thus include all current transfers between resident and nonresident individuals. Compensation of employees refers to the income of border, seasonal, and other short-term workers who are employed in an economy where they are not resident and of residents employed by nonresident entities. Data are the sum of two items defined in the sixth edition of the IMF's Balance of Payments Manual: personal transfers and compensation of employees.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
